After #23007 reclassified integrated CUDA/HIP devices as IGPU, the device
selection logic dropped the local iGPU whenever any RPC server was added,
because RPC devices made `model->devices` non-empty. On systems where the
"iGPU" is the main compute device (e.g. Strix Halo with 128 GiB of unified
memory), this caused all tensors to be allocated on the RPC peer alone and
model loading to fail.
Gate the iGPU inclusion on `gpus.empty()` instead, so RPC peers no longer
suppress the local iGPU.
closes: #23858
* CUDA: Check PTX version on host side to guard PDL dispatch
Checking on `__CUDA_ARCH_LIST__` alone is insufficient for JIT, as this
variable doesn't differentiate between compiling for say sm_90, sm_90a
or sm_90f (so forward-jittable PTX vs. arch/family-specific PTX).
Thus, one can have a bug when compiling with
`DCMAKE_CUDA_ARCHITECTURES="89;90a"`, where current code would wrongly
dispatch to PDL on sm_90/sm_120 in forward-JIT mode.
This PR fixes this issue by checking `cudaFuncAttributes::ptxVersion` of
the incoming kernel at runtime. A check on ptxVersion alone is
sufficient, as device-codes will always be >= ptxVersion (and any
violation of this would be a severe bug in CUDA/nvcc), see:
https://docs.nvidia.com/cuda/cuda-compiler-driver-nvcc/#gpu-code-code-code
